About “Project Sekai” in a few words:

“Project Sekai” is an anime series that revolves around the collaboration between virtual singers and real-life high school students. These students discover that they can enter a virtual world where they team up with virtual singers to perform and share their music. Throughout the series, viewers are introduced to various SEKAI groups, each with their own distinct style and story. The series beautifully blends the allure of virtual reality with the struggles and joys of reality, all tied together by the powerful theme of music.
